BMI is a population-level screening measure. It does not directly measure body fat, fitness or health and can be misleading for some people.
BMI formula for US unitsBMI = 703 × weight (lb) ÷ height² (in)
A practical example
A person who is 5 ft 10 in and weighs 170 lb has a BMI of about 24.4.
